Freeman Vines: Hanging Tree Guitars

For decades, artist Freeman Vines has made guitars in his shop in eastern North Carolina using found objects, including wood from a tree where a man was once lynched. In addition to Vines' haunting sculptures, the Hanging Tree Guitars exhibition also includes a number of tintype photographs by Timothy Duffy. Freeman Vines' sculpture and words are the subject of the forthcoming book "Hanging Tree Guitars" by Freeman Vines with Timothy Duffy and Zoe Van Buren.

The Southeastern Center for Contemporary Art (SECCA) is proud to present Hanging Tree Guitars, the powerful exhibition of sculptures by NC–based artist, guitar maker and one-time blues musician Freeman Vines. The exhibition will be on view in SECCA's Main Gallery from June 10 through September 12, 2021.

SECCA is an affiliate of the NC Museum of Art and a division of the NC Department of Natural & Cultural Resources.
